People with dyslexia have problems with reading words accurately and with ease (sometimes called "fluency") and may have a hard time spelling, understanding sentences, and recognizing words they already know. Individuals with dyscalculia struggle with math concepts, numbers, and reasoning.1 Sometimes referred to as having math dyslexia, individuals might have difficulty reading clocks to tell time, counting money, identifying patterns, remembering math facts, and solving mental math.4, In auditory processing disorder (APD), patients have difficulty processing sounds. Visual perceptual/visual motor deficit, Individuals with visual perceptual/visual motor deficit exhibit poor hand-eye coordination, often lose their places when reading, and have difficulty with pencils, crayons, glue, scissors, and other fine motor activities.
